Hi I'm developing a code using the most recent version of Matlab but I having trouble to figured out how to create a correct nested loop.
My code is actually quite long and for academic reasons I can not show it here, but let's say that I'm trying to nest 3 different loops: one loop to create multiple arrays with vectors inside each array, then another loop to create a set of initial conditions depending on those arrays from the previous loop and finally one loop to iterate for a fixed number of times a system of ODES, using those initial conditions. For all the loops I'm using the for coomand of course.
I tried before with 2 loops and it worked correctly but when I try to add the third loop I got several errors most of them about wrong variables and not enough input arguments, so I'm assuming that the order in which the loops are nested is not correct but I would like to hear any suggestion or if is possible an example of how you can nest multiple loops in a proper manner. I know that without a code would be very hard to find a good solution but it would be nice if someone can share any problems similar to this and how it was fixed.
